We calculate the $^1S_0$ pairing gap in nuclear matter by adopting the "in-medium Bonn potential" proposed by Rapp et al. [e-print nucl-th/9706006], which takes into account the in-medium meson mass decrease, as the particle-particle interaction in the gap equation. The resulting gap is significantly reduced in comparison with the one obtained by adopting the original Bonn potential.
